If you drive in highway, and having a crash, most people just leave the wreckage on the side of the highway as log as it's not stopping the traffic. It's Dangerous. Imagine you having a crash, then your crashed car spun off to one of wreck like this...

Kinja'd!!!

There's also an american land yacht..

Kinja'd!!!

And a truck..

Kinja'd!!!



And many, many other. From Abu Dhabi to Dubai, about 100 miles, there's at least 150 wrecks like this. that's means 3 wrecks for about 2 miles. And that's the wrecks only. Not including the Hagwalah, The car stone, the guy that want to see how fast his lambo can go, and many, many other. Arabian highways is quite dangerous. Slightly more dangerous than the indonesian, in my opinion.
